WebFeb 6, 2024 · In 1929, London Rowing Club experimented with ‘syncopated rowing’ whereby each pair in an eight took the catch a quarter of a stroke after the pair in front so that four oars were always in the water. As the system demanded more space between the rowers, a longer eight was built with the cox seated in the centre between ‘4’ and ‘5’.
